Summary
Vulnerability in macOS (Sequoia, Sonoma, Tahoe) allowing an attacker to cause unexpected system termination or corrupt kernel memory. Fixed with improved memory handling.
Risk Assessment
An attacker may cause system crashes (DoS) or corrupt kernel memory, potentially enabling privilege escalation.
Recommendation
Update systems to macOS Sequoia 15.7.8, macOS Sonoma 14.8.8, or macOS Tahoe 26.6.
